Abstract
There is provided a method for producing a Cu-Sn-containing steel which, even in hot working using a heating furnace with a low heating capacity, can prevent surface cracking of a Cu-Sn-containing steel and avoid troubles in the heating furnace, thus enabling stable production of the steel. The method for producing a Cu-Sn-containing steel includes: a hot heating step of attaching a first flux, which includes at least one of B<2>O<3>, P<2>O<5>, K<2>O, PbO, Na<2>O-FeO, Na<2>O-SiO<2>, Na<2>O-TiO<2>, and Li<2>O-SiO<2> as a component, and has a liquid fraction of 10 mass % or more at 1000°C, to a surface of a Cu-Sn-containing slab such that the mass of the first flux per unit area of the surface of the slab falls within the range of not less than 50 g/m<2> and not more than 5000 g/m<2>, and then attaching a second flux, which has a liquid fraction of 0 mass % at 1400°C or lower, to the surface of the Cu-Sn-containing slab such that the mass of the second flux per unit area of the surface of the slab falls within the range of not less than 50 g/m<2> and not more than 5000 g/m<2>, and heating the Cu-Sn-containing slab at a temperature of not less than 1000°C and not more than 1400°C; and a hot working step of hot-working the Cu-Sn-containing slab.
